  • Dust cap stuck in pigtail

    Dust cap stuck in pigtail

    Try using some penetrating oil like PB Blaster to see if that helps, maybe get heat involved to cause the metal of the cap to expand, maybe it will expand enough that the set screw will come out. Be careful with heat that you don't melt the rubber of the valve. I have found using a couple of small drops of silicon that comes in a spray can will free up stuck or frozen aluminum to aluminum threads. If not, you can try tapping a slightly oversized torx bit in. This dust cap was stuck as the allen bolt hole had become rounded, making it impossible to remove by normal method. It seems the pigtail holder gets brittle with age and is easy to break.   • When should the pigtail plate be replaced

    When should the pigtail plate be replaced

    These connectors frequently require replacement when the plastic housing becomes brittle and cracks, or the internal metal terminals corrode from moisture exposure. What Is a Pigtail in Automotive Wiring? Short answer: An automotive wiring pigtail is a short section of wire with a pre-attached connector that lets you repair or replace a damaged plug without replacing the entire harness.
